What this Trial Is About
This study will implement a Western Diet (WD) to understand cardiometabolic and immune function in middle-aged adults (50- 64 years old). Vascular health, intestinal permeability, and T-cell function will be examined before, during, and after the WD. The WD is a 10-day diet and will consist of 25% of total energy from added sugars.

Who Can Participate
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if you...
- Ability to provide informed consent
- Men and postmenopausal women aged 50 to 64 years
- Systolic blood pressure less than 130 mmHg and diastolic blood pressure less than 90 mmHg
- Body mass index (BMI) less than 30 kg/m2 and body fat percentage less than 25% for men and less than 33% for women
- Fasting triglycerides less than 200 mg/dl
- Low density lipoprotein (LDL) cholesterol less than 160 mg/dl
- Fasting plasma glucose less than 126 mg/dl
- Weight stable for the prior 6 months with 2 kg or less weight change
- Blood tests showing normal liver enzymes and kidney function with estimated glomerular filtration rate over 60 ml/min/1.73 m2
You will not qualify if you...
- Use of medications or supplements that lower blood triglycerides or cholesterol (e.g., fibrates, statins, high dose niacin, high dose omega-3)
- Chronic clinical diseases such as coronary artery, peripheral artery, cerebrovascular diseases, heart failure, diabetes, chronic kidney disease requiring dialysis, neurological or autoimmune conditions affecting cognition (e.g., Alzheimer's disease, dementia, Parkinson's disease, epilepsy, multiple sclerosis, large vessel infarct)
- Major psychiatric disorders like schizophrenia or bipolar disorder
- Current or past use within 3 months of anti-hypertensive or cardiovascular medications affecting vascular function or arterial stiffness
- Current use of medications affecting central nervous system function (e.g., long active benzodiazepines)
- Concussion within the last 2 years or 3 or more lifetime concussions
- Heavy alcohol consumption (8 or more drinks per week for women, 15 or more drinks per week for men)
- Major change in health status in the past 6 months such as surgery, significant infection, or illness
- Smoking within the past 3 months
